Libertyville hosts environmental movie series
The first in a series of environmental movies will be shown at 6 p.m. and 7:30 p.m. June 3 at the Libertyville village hall, 118 West Cook Ave. “Green Fire” is about Aldo Leopold, a conservation legend who grew up in Iowa, graduated from Yale and later in life had a house he referred to as “the shack” on the Wisconsin River north of Madison. The documentary shares how Leopold’s land ethic and belief in caring about people and the land continues to inspire the environmental movement today. The series is sponsored by the Lake County Health Department and Illinois Lakes Management Association as part of MainStreet Libertyville’s First Friday events. Admission and popcorn are free. First Friday also is scheduled for July 1 and Aug. 5.
